摘要
We have measured the proton elliptic flow excitation function for the Au + Au system spanning the beam energy range (2-8)A GeV. The excitation function shows a transition from negative to positive elliptic flow at a beam energy, E-tr similar to 4A GeV. Detailed comparisons with calculations from a relativistic Boltzmann equation are presented. The comparisons suggest a softening of the nuclear equation of state from a stiff form (K similar to 380 MeV) at low beam energies (E-beam less than or equal to 2A GeV) to a softer form (K similar to 210 MeV) at higher energies (E-beam 4A GeV) where the calculated baryon density rho similar to 4 rho(0).
